Towards a Joint Vision on H2 Infrastructure Roll-Out

Published on: June 5, 2011

Over the past months EHA has contributed to numerous EU policy activities to prepare Europe’s future transport infrastructure. As Daimler is anticipating its first series production with one year to 2014,  an overall vision on future hydrogen production, distribution and  refuelling infrastructure roll-out needs to become part of the EU’s large transport and energy infrastructure investment programs now. The EHA  together with its 19 national member association and in collaboration with the more than 30 regions in HyER (formerly HyRaMP) could play a key role in identifying national and local stakeholders that could facilitate market uptake and indicate specific needs and requirements.

Through Consultations on the Strategic Transport and Technology Plan, Smart Cities Initiative and contributions to the DG MOVE  Future Fuels Expert Group and the working Groups and Hearing  Cars 21 , EHA emphasized the need to start integrating hydrogen requirements in current transport and energy infrastructure planning while underlining the need to include hydrogen in large scale energy storage projects as announced by Commissioner Oettinger and in smart grids facilitating the deployment of low carbon transport applications.

H2 Expo 2011 – The International Conference and Exhibition on Hydrogen, Fuel Cells and Electric Drives

H2 Expo 2011 will be held for the eighth time this year in Hamburg, the European Green Capital.  The International Conference and Exhibition on Hydrogen, Fuel Cells and Electric Drives will provide the opportunity to discuss the latest trends and developments in mobile, stationary and portable applications. The focus will be on the latest applications in the automotive, maritime, aerospace and energy supply industries. For the first time, H2Expo will also cover the closely related fields of electric drive technology, electric energy storage systems and hybrid systems.
The two-day conference and the accompanying trade fair will bring together suppliers and potential customers from the market  and offer exhibitors the chance to make new business contacts.

Zero Rally 2011

Zero Rally 2011, arranged by Zero Emission Resource Organisation (ZERO), is a race for battery electric, plug-in hybrid, bio powered and hydrogen vehicles. The 600+ km rally, will start in Hamar on June 7 and will finish two days later in Oslo.
